Lines Matching +full:vm +full:- +full:map

13 #include "ui/dbus-display1.h"
48 *qts = qtest_init("-display dbus,p2p=yes -name dbus-test"); in test_setup()
52 qtest_qmp_add_client(*qts, "@dbus-display", pair[1]); in test_setup()
63 g_autoptr(QemuDBusDisplay1VMProxy) vm = NULL; in test_dbus_display_vm()
68 vm = QEMU_DBUS_DISPLAY1_VM_PROXY( in test_dbus_display_vm()
73 DBUS_DISPLAY1_ROOT "/VM", in test_dbus_display_vm()
79 qemu_dbus_display1_vm_get_name(QEMU_DBUS_DISPLAY1_VM(vm)), in test_dbus_display_vm()
81 "dbus-test"); in test_dbus_display_vm()
103 if (!test->with_map) { in listener_handle_scanout()
104 g_main_loop_quit(test->loop); in listener_handle_scanout()
123 int fd = -1; in listener_handle_scanout_map()
134 g_assert_no_errno(addr == MAP_FAILED ? -1 : 0); in listener_handle_scanout_map()
137 g_main_loop_quit(test->loop); in listener_handle_scanout_map()
150 test->server = g_dbus_object_manager_server_new(DBUS_DISPLAY1_ROOT); in test_dbus_console_setup_listener()
155 "signal::handle-scanout", listener_handle_scanout, test, in test_dbus_console_setup_listener()
161 g_test_skip("map test lacking on win32"); in test_dbus_console_setup_listener()
169 "signal::handle-scanout-map", listener_handle_scanout_map, test, in test_dbus_console_setup_listener()
174 (const gchar *[]) { "org.qemu.Display1.Listener.Unix.Map", NULL }, in test_dbus_console_setup_listener()
178 g_dbus_object_manager_server_export(test->server, listener); in test_dbus_console_setup_listener()
179 g_dbus_object_manager_server_set_connection(test->server, in test_dbus_console_setup_listener()
180 test->listener_conn); in test_dbus_console_setup_listener()
182 g_dbus_connection_start_message_processing(test->listener_conn); in test_dbus_console_setup_listener()
201 g_test_skip("The VM doesn't have a console!"); in test_dbus_console_registered()
202 g_main_loop_quit(test->loop); in test_dbus_console_registered()
208 test->listener_conn = g_thread_join(test->thread); in test_dbus_console_registered()
209 test_dbus_console_setup_listener(test, test->with_map); in test_dbus_console_registered()
281 -1, in test_dbus_display_console()
323 -1, in test_dbus_display_keyboard()
327 g_test_skip("The VM doesn't have a console!"); in test_dbus_display_keyboard()
342 -1, in test_dbus_display_keyboard()
362 qtest_add_func("/dbus-display/vm", test_dbus_display_vm); in main()
363 qtest_add_data_func("/dbus-display/console", GINT_TO_POINTER(false), test_dbus_display_console); in main()
364 …qtest_add_data_func("/dbus-display/console/map", GINT_TO_POINTER(true), test_dbus_display_console); in main()
365 qtest_add_func("/dbus-display/keyboard", test_dbus_display_keyboard); in main()